◉ one motor neuron pathway. Answer: somatic nervous system


◉ two motor neuron pathway. Answer: autonomic nervous system


◉ preganglionic and postganglion neurons. Answer: autonomic
nervous system


◉ ganglia near the spinal cord. Answer: sympathetic nervous
system


◉ preganglionic neuron fibers arise from the thoracic and lumbar
regions of the spinal cord. Answer: sympathetic nervous system


◉ short preganglionic neuron fibers. Answer: sympathetic nervous
system

,◉ long postganglionic neuron fibers. Answer: sympathetic nervous
system


◉ preganglionic neuron fibers arise from the cervical and sacral
spinal regions of the spinal cord. Answer: parasympathetic nervous
system


◉ ganglia located near or within target organs. Answer:
parasympathetic nervous system


◉ long preganglionic neurons. Answer: parasympathetic nervous
system


◉ short postganglionic neurons. Answer: parasympathetic nervous
system


◉ all preganglionic fibers release this neurotransmitter. Answer:
acetylcholine


◉ cholinergic receptors bind this neurotransmitter. Answer:
acetylcholine


◉ postganglionic parasympathetic fibers. Answer: cholinergic
(release acetylcholine, ACh)

, ◉ postganglionic sympathetic fibers. Answer: adrenergic (release
norepinephrine, NE)


◉ pathway of a polysynaptic reflex arc. Answer: Stimulus
Receptor
Afferent/sensory neurons
Integration/Interneurons (polysynaptic reflexes only)
Efferent/motor neurons
Effector

◉ What is missing from a monosynaptic reflex pathway?. Answer:
interneurons

◉ Given an example of a polysynaptic reflex. Answer: the
withdrawal reflex


◉ Give an example of a monosynaptic reflex. Answer: most stretch
reflexes
